AllianceBernstein (AB) stock outlook | growth expectations and technical momentum remain in focus. AllianceBernstein Holding L.P. (AB) shares traded at $36.96, posting a minimal decline of 0.38% in the latest session. The stock remains within a defined range, with immediate support near $35.11 and resistance at $38.81. This price action suggests a period of consolidation as investors weigh sector dynamics and broader market influences.
